This half-day tour typically begins in the early morning at 8:00 am, a time when Florida’s calm waters and active fish populations offer the best chance for a successful outing. The meeting point is the Belleair Causeway Boat Ramp, a well-known spot for launching fishing adventures near Clearwater.
Once aboard, you’ll be led by a USCG-certified captain, ensuring safety and professional guidance throughout the trip. The boat will take you to various fishing spots—near beaches, inshore against mangroves, or on flats—depending on the season and where the fish are biting that day. This variability keeps the experience dynamic and engaging, as you might be casting your line in different environments.
The tour’s flexibility is one of its strengths. The captain adjusts the location based on seasonal fish activity, aiming to maximize your chances of catching something. How long does the tour last?
The tour is approximately 4 hours, providing enough time to fish, relax, and take in the scenery without feeling rushed.
What is included in the price?
All bait, tackle, rods, and fishing licenses are included, so you only need to bring yourself and perhaps some snacks if you wish (they are not provided).
Can I cancel if the weather isn’t good?
Yes, cancellations are free if made at least 24 hours in advance. If weather conditions are poor, you’ll be offered a different date or a full refund.
Is this tour suitable for children?
Absolutely. It’s described as family-friendly, and reviews mention Captain Phil’s good rapport with kids, making it a fun outing for families.
Where do we meet for the tour?
The tour begins at the Belleair Causeway Boat Ramp, with multiple pickup points available, including locations as far north as Dunedin.
How many people can join the tour?
Up to 4 guests can be on board at once, which makes for a very personalized experience.
